
The question of whether it is legally required for dental hygienists to wear loupes has sparked considerable debate within the dental community. While loupes, or magnifying glasses, are widely recognized for enhancing precision and reducing physical strain during procedures, their use is not universally mandated by law in all jurisdictions. Instead, regulations often vary by country, state, or professional governing bodies, which may recommend or require their use as part of best practice standards. In some regions, occupational health and safety guidelines emphasize the importance of loupes to prevent musculoskeletal disorders, but these are typically framed as recommendations rather than strict legal obligations. As a result, the decision to wear loupes often rests on a combination of professional judgment, workplace policies, and individual preference, highlighting the need for clarity and consistency in industry standards.

Legal requirements for dental hygienists' magnification tools in different countries
In the United States, there is no federal law that explicitly mandates dental hygienists to wear magnification tools such as loupes. However, the Occupational Safety and Health Administration (OSHA) emphasizes the importance of ergonomic practices and the use of tools that enhance precision and reduce physical strain. Many state dental boards and professional organizations, like the American Dental Hygienists' Association (ADHA), strongly recommend the use of loupes to improve clinical accuracy and reduce the risk of musculoskeletal disorders. While not legally required, educational institutions and employers often encourage or require their use as part of best practice standards.
In the United Kingdom, the General Dental Council (GDC) does not specifically mandate the use of loupes for dental hygienists. However, the GDC’s Standards for the Dental Team emphasize the need for professionals to use appropriate equipment to deliver safe and effective care. The British Society of Dental Hygiene and Therapy (BSDHT) also advocates for the use of magnification tools to enhance clinical outcomes and protect practitioners from occupational hazards. While not a legal requirement, the use of loupes is widely considered essential for meeting professional standards.
In Canada, regulations regarding the use of loupes for dental hygienists vary by province. For example, in Ontario, the College of Dental Hygienists of Ontario (CDHO) does not mandate the use of loupes but encourages their use as part of ergonomic and clinical best practices. Similarly, in British Columbia, the College of Dental Hygienists of British Columbia (CDHBC) promotes the use of magnification tools to improve precision and reduce physical strain. While not legally required nationwide, provincial regulatory bodies often highlight the importance of loupes in professional guidelines.
In Australia, the Dental Board of Australia, under the Australian Health Practitioner Regulation Agency (AHPRA), does not explicitly require dental hygienists to wear loupes. However, the Board’s Code of Conduct and guidelines stress the importance of using appropriate equipment to ensure high-quality patient care. Professional associations, such as the Dental Hygienists Association of Australia (DHAA), strongly recommend the use of magnification tools to enhance clinical performance and protect practitioners from occupational injuries. As in other countries, while not a legal requirement, the use of loupes is widely encouraged.

Benefits of using loupes for precision and posture in hygiene practice
While there is no universal law mandating dental hygienists to wear loupes, their use offers significant benefits for precision and posture in hygiene practice. Loupes, essentially magnifying glasses worn like glasses, provide a closer, more detailed view of the oral cavity. This enhanced visualization allows hygienists to identify calculus, plaque, and early signs of decay with greater accuracy. For instance, the ability to see subgingival calculus deposits clearly enables more thorough scaling and root planing, leading to improved patient outcomes.
Precision is paramount in dental hygiene, and loupes directly contribute to this by magnifying the working area. This magnification allows for more controlled and precise instrument manipulation, reducing the risk of tissue damage and ensuring a more comfortable experience for the patient. Think of it as the difference between painting a miniature with a broad brush versus a fine-tipped one – loupes provide the precision needed for meticulous work.
Beyond precision, loupes significantly improve posture for hygienists. Traditional dental hygiene posture often involves leaning forward and hunching over patients, leading to neck, shoulder, and back strain over time. Loupes, by bringing the work area closer to the hygienist's eyes, encourage a more upright posture. This ergonomic benefit reduces the risk of musculoskeletal disorders, a common occupational hazard in the dental field.

Occupational health and safety standards related to loupes usage
While there isn't a universal law mandating dental hygienists to wear loupes, occupational health and safety standards strongly recommend their use. These standards, often outlined by organizations like the Occupational Safety and Health Administration (OSHA) in the United States and similar bodies worldwide, emphasize the importance of ergonomic practices and eye protection in dental settings. Dental hygienists frequently perform intricate procedures requiring close visual inspection, which can lead to strain on the eyes, neck, and back without proper magnification and posture support. Loupes provide the necessary magnification to reduce eye strain and improve precision, thereby minimizing the risk of occupational injuries.
Ergonomic considerations are a cornerstone of occupational health and safety standards related to loupes usage. Prolonged work in awkward postures, such as leaning over patients, can cause musculoskeletal disorders (MSDs), which are a leading cause of workplace injuries in the dental profession. Loupes help hygienists maintain a neutral posture by allowing them to work at a comfortable distance from the patient while still achieving the necessary level of detail. Many standards recommend that loupes be customized to the individual user to ensure optimal alignment and comfort, reducing the risk of neck and back pain.
Eye protection is another critical aspect of occupational health and safety standards. Dental procedures often involve the use of sharp instruments, high-speed handpieces, and aerosol-generating tools, which pose risks of eye injuries from debris, splashes, or chemical exposure. Loupes with integrated safety lenses or side shields can provide additional protection, aligning with OSHA’s guidelines for personal protective equipment (PPE). While loupes themselves are not solely designed as safety glasses, their use can complement other protective measures to create a safer working environment.
Training and education are essential components of occupational health and safety standards related to loupes usage. Employers are often required to provide training on the proper selection, fitting, and maintenance of loupes to ensure their effectiveness. This includes guidance on adjusting the loupes for correct magnification, working distance, and declination angle to avoid discomfort and injury. Regular assessments of the workplace environment, including lighting and workstation setup, are also recommended to maximize the benefits of loupes and comply with ergonomic standards.

Alternatives to loupes and their compliance with dental regulations
While loupes are widely recommended and often considered essential for dental hygienists, they are not universally mandated by law. However, dental regulations prioritize ergonomics, infection control, and patient safety, which loupes significantly contribute to. For hygienists seeking alternatives, it’s crucial to ensure any substitute meets these regulatory standards. Below are detailed alternatives and their compliance considerations:
Ergonomic Magnification Devices: Head-Mounted Cameras and Screens
Head-mounted cameras paired with small screens or monitors can provide magnification similar to loupes. These devices are particularly useful for hygienists who find traditional loupes uncomfortable. However, compliance with dental regulations requires ensuring the device does not obstruct the hygienist’s field of vision or compromise infection control. The equipment must be sterilized or disinfected between patients, and its use should align with ergonomic guidelines to prevent strain. Additionally, the magnification quality must meet clinical standards to ensure accurate diagnosis and treatment, as outlined in regulations like OSHA (Occupational Safety and Health Administration) and CDC (Centers for Disease Control and Prevention) guidelines.
Microscopes and Overhead Lighting with Magnification
Dental microscopes or overhead lights equipped with magnification features are another alternative. These tools are stationary and provide high-quality magnification without the need for head-worn devices. Compliance with regulations involves ensuring the equipment is properly maintained and calibrated to avoid distortion or inadequate lighting. Infection control protocols must be strictly followed, as these devices are often shared or used in close proximity to patients. While they may not offer the same mobility as loupes, they can be suitable for specific procedures and settings, provided they meet ergonomic and safety standards.
Handheld Magnifiers and Illuminated Tools
Handheld magnifiers or illuminated dental instruments can serve as temporary alternatives to loupes. However, their compliance with regulations is more limited. Handheld tools may not provide the same level of precision or ergonomic benefit, potentially leading to fatigue or reduced efficiency. For regulatory compliance, hygienists must ensure these tools are sterilized appropriately and do not compromise patient safety. Additionally, their use should be supplemental rather than a primary magnification method, as they may not meet the stringent requirements for detailed dental procedures.
Prescription Safety Glasses with Magnification
Prescription safety glasses with built-in magnification can be a viable alternative for hygienists who require vision correction. These glasses must comply with ANSI (American National Standards Institute) standards for safety eyewear and provide adequate magnification for dental procedures. Infection control is critical; the glasses should be easy to clean and disinfect between patients. While this option addresses both vision correction and magnification needs, hygienists must ensure the magnification level is sufficient for clinical tasks, as inadequate magnification could violate regulatory standards for patient care.
